Understanding Cephalopod Intelligence

Cephalopods possess a unique nervous system, which is significantly different from that of most other invertebrates. Their brains are large relative to their body size, and a significant portion of their neurons are located in their arms. This decentralized nervous system allows for complex movements and problem-solving capabilities, making them one of the most intelligent invertebrates on the planet.

Problem Solving and Tool Use

One of the most astounding aspects of cephalopod intelligence is their ability to solve problems and use tools. For instance, octopuses have been observed using coconut shells and rocks as shelters or weapons, demonstrating a level of foresight and planning that is rare in the animal kingdom. Studies have shown that octopuses can navigate mazes and escape from enclosures, showcasing their impressive cognitive skills.

Communication and Camouflage

Cephalopods are also masters of communication and camouflage. They can change color and texture rapidly, using specialized skin cells called chromatophores. This ability not only helps them blend into their surroundings to avoid predators but also plays a crucial role in social interactions and mating displays. By altering their appearance, cephalopods can convey messages to each other, signaling aggression, submission, or readiness to mate.

Social Behavior and Learning

Although traditionally thought of as solitary creatures, some cephalopods exhibit social behaviors. For example, certain species of octopuses have been observed engaging in playful interactions and even forming temporary alliances. Additionally, cephalopods display a remarkable capacity for learning through observation, which is a hallmark of advanced intelligence. They can learn from the experiences of others, adapting their behavior based on social cues.

Cephalopods and Their Environment

Cephalopods play a vital role in marine ecosystems. As both predators and prey, they contribute to the balance of oceanic food webs. Their intelligence aids them in adapting to different environments, whether it be the deep sea or coral reefs. By understanding their behaviors and ecological roles, scientists can gain insights into the health of marine ecosystems and the impacts of climate change.

Conservation Challenges

Despite their incredible adaptations and intelligence, cephalopods face numerous threats in the wild. Overfishing, habitat destruction, and climate change pose significant risks to their populations. Conservation efforts are essential to ensure the survival of these remarkable creatures. Protecting their habitats and regulating fishing practices can help maintain healthy cephalopod populations, which are crucial for oceanic biodiversity.
